Transaction dd3adc35afaf78eaeee7cbd1be46cb67e319fc47aa2e0c98247fc82e416eec52
1 Input
1 Output
-
dd3adc35afaf78eaeee7cbd1be46cb67e319fc47aa2e0c98247fc82e416eec52:0
- value
- 138371
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a4954dcbf34cb27de0416e11dfa3598ecf0e451d OP_EQUAL
- address
- 3GhFbpXnduZvRbg9CTaYGq4RLVyMSx7tVR